Lot 2 | A SET OF SIX WILLIAM III WALNUT SIDE CHAIRS
Valeur estimée
£ 5 000 – 8 000
CIRCA 1700, IN THE MANNER OF DANIEL MAROT
The high backs with crestings centred by fleur-de-lis, the central pierced foliate splats centred by a carved rosette flanked by plain columns above caned seats on tapering, bulbous turned supports joined by an x-shaped stretcher, together with five pink damask seat pads each with a 19th century needle-work panel, old repairs and restorations
52 ½ in. (133.5 cm) high; 23 ½ in. (60 cm.) wide; 22 ½ in. (58 cm.) deep
Provenance
By repute: Anna Maria Sandys, née Colbrooke, 1720-1806, wife of Edwin Sandys, 2nd Baron Sandys (1726-1797) and by descent.
Literature
Ombersley Court Inventory, June 1963, annotated Ombersley MS, in The Grand Hall.
